AI Summary
-
Appropriates $10,000,000 from the General Revenue Fund to the Illinois State Board of Education for grants to provide after-school, art-based programs in schools with low-income pupil counts greater than 70% as certified by the Department of Human Services.
-
Appropriates $10,000,000 from the General Revenue Fund to the Illinois Arts Council for community art programs located in census tracts at 125% below the poverty level according to the United States Census Bureau to administer arts education and art therapy programs.
-
Total appropriation of $20,000,000 for art programs targeting low-income communities and schools.
-
Takes effect July 1, 2019.
